Find organisations that support veterans and their families

This directory lists organisations that provide support to veterans of the UK armed forces and their families.

You can filter results by location and select as many areas of support as you need.

This should not be taken as an exhaustive list of all services on offer to veterans and their families in the UK.

Get help with VALOUR

VALOUR makes it easier for veterans and their families to find and access support across the UK, in the way that works best for them.

You can get help:

  • online
  • by phone, email or online referral
  • in person at one of our nationwide VALOUR-recognised centres
